Job Description - Xceptor Developer (Business Analysis Associate I)

Job Description :

As an Operations Analyst within our Mortgage Backed Securities team, you will be tasked with the allocation and delivery of mortgaged back securities (MBS), while ensuring compliance with investor and regulatory requirements. Your role will involve promoting end-to-end loan quality, identifying opportunities for operational reengineering, and leading citizen developer/automation initiatives to streamline salability processes. You will have the chance to shape and enhance our loan quality processes using data transformation tools such as Alteryx, Python, SQL, etc. Additional responsibilities include process flow documentation, procedures, complex data analysis/reporting, and executive presentations.

Job Responsibilities

  • Performs loan sales operational and control tasks including end to end pooling - allocation, defect identification/remediation, and oversight.
  • Comprehends investor data requirements and accurately cure related loan quality edits efficiently
  • Understands and develops automation solutions for internal operational workflows and build tools which will optimize and reduce manual processes
  • Identifies and leads citizen developer/automation initiatives to benefit streamlined salability processes
  • Creates reporting, interpret results and convey in a concise, straight-forward, and professional manner for all levels of operational staff from supervisors to senior level management
  • Spearheads projects & tasks by ensuring timely completion and articulate any issues and risks to management
  • Ensures the integrity of data through automated extraction, translation, processing, analysis, and reporting
